KATHMANDU, Dec 3: The price of gold decreased by Rs 200 on Friday. The price of gold in the domestic market has been fixed at Rs 91,300 per tola now.



The yellow metal was traded at Rs 91,500 per tola on Thursday. According to the Federation of Nepal Gold and Silver Dealers’ Association, Friday's price of standard gold is Rs 90,800 per tola, which was Rs 91,000 per tola on Thursday.

According to the federation, silver price has remained stable to Rs 1,190 per tola. The federation has been fixing the price of gold and silver in Nepal in line with the transaction price of the international market.


Similarly, in the international market, gold is being traded at USD 1775.15 per ounce today.
